Abbey considered for international award

INTERNATIONAL judges have been exploring an award winning abbey.

Judges from The Royal Institution of Chartered Surveyors (RICS) visited Beeleigh Abbey, near Maldon, on Monday August 4 to consider it for an international award.

The abbey, restored and repaired by owners Christopher and Catherine Foyle, has already won the RICS East of England Building Conservation Award 2008 following the high quality of the work completed.

And now the Grade I listed property has been shortlisted for the final and inspected by the judges.

RICS east operations director David Potter said: "The fact that Beeleigh Abbey has already won the regional conservation award is a testament to the high standard of workmanship achieved during its restoration and the positive contribution the project is already making to people's lives."

The awards celebrate and recognise projects across four categories including building conservation, regeneration, sustainability and commuity benefit.

Grand Designs presenter Kevin McCloud will announce the overall winners at a gala awards ceremony at The Millenium Hotel, Mayfair, on October 17, 2008.
